Output e590f8840ef2b378013304778dd7c3f73d86eb6f415c51dff66a37ebfca137b8:0

value
26139157
script pubkey
OP_0 OP_PUSHBYTES_20 507c39194e59673fae25c3bfcc0d09733b9defeb
address
bc1q2p7rjx2wt9nnlt39cwlucrgfwvaemmltcf50hd
transaction
e590f8840ef2b378013304778dd7c3f73d86eb6f415c51dff66a37ebfca137b8